Dongping Xie has authored 41 papers that have received a total of 840 indexed citations.
This includes 8 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Materials Chemistry and 6 papers in Social Psychology. The topics of these papers are Neuroendocrine regulation and behavior (6 papers), Neuropeptides and Animal Physiology (4 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(4 papers). Dongping Xie is often cited by papers focused on Neuroendocrine regulation and behavior (6 papers), Neuropeptides and Animal Physiology (4 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(4 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and France. Dongping Xie's co-authors include Kirk S. Schanze, Lian-Bi Chen, Xinwen Chang, Chuanyong Liu and Hua Lu and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, ACS Nano and Gastroenterology.
